Eos Press is a publisher of games originally established in 2001 in Seattle, Washington as Hawthorn Hobgoblynn Press.

As Hobgoblynn they released the role-playing game Godlike. The company was relaunched on March 16, 2003,[1] and is currently comprised of Hsin Chen, Brad Elliott and Aron Anderson.

Now that Godlike is behind them, Eos Press focuses on the production of card games (such as Abuse: The Final Insult and Creatures & Cultists) and role-playing games (such as Weapons of the Gods and the upcoming Unhallowed Metropolis).
